Noah awoke—and knew what his younger, &c.— Noah when awaking would find the garment upon him, which Shem and Japheth had brought, and would thence, doubtless, be led to inquire whence and how it came, and so would know, by information, what his younger son had done unto him: words which plainly intimate more than bare seeing, and shew, that something irreverent and disrespectful had been done by that younger son.
